Output df6423bcf59c7327e6d626bbe96a12a1d32512148e0db7bdc4f881ed5d7d6d81:0

value
655806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738778d5256bdcecf3affb91693a0b6a57b97558 OP_EQUAL
address
3CDsvN4ivLugWcXPWrwd5bshw4gfZVThdP
transaction
df6423bcf59c7327e6d626bbe96a12a1d32512148e0db7bdc4f881ed5d7d6d81